Join in parklife celebration

Residents across the Capital are being encouraged to take part in events to mark the national Love Parks Week.

Events will be held across the city from today until Friday encouraging people to visit, enjoy and take pride in green spaces.

There are more than 130 parks in Edinburgh, ranging from small community parks, to natural heritage parks and large premier parks.

Councillor Lesley Hinds, environment leader, said: “Attractive and well-presented parks and green spaces are fundamentally important to maintaining the quality of life in Edinburgh.

“We take particular pride in ensuring good outdoor spaces are accessible to all and the city has the highest number of Green Flag parks in the 
country.

“Although the weather might not be the best at the moment, we’re still hoping lots of people will turn out next week to visit their local park and take part in some of the events.”
